When was the modern nicotine vapor device invented? A concise timeline

Short answer: the modern commercialized e-cigarette that launched a global vaping market is most often attributed to the work of a Chinese pharmacist in the early 2000s. However, the idea of an electronic or smokeless cigarette has antecedents stretching back decades. Below is a compact timeline that connects these threads and offers the nuance that searchers seeking when was e cigarette invented usually want.

  1. Early concepts (1920s–1960s) — Inventive engineers and health-conscious hobbyists explored nicotine delivery via non-combustion methods. There were patents and prototypes proposing electric vaporization of nicotine or flavored solutions much earlier than the 21st century, reflecting a recurring interest in safer inhalation alternatives.
  2. Patent-era developments (1960s–1990s) — Several inventors applied for patents describing devices that heated a flavored liquid or nicotine without burning tobacco. These patents were mostly dormant or commercially unused for decades, but they established technical groundwork for heating elements, reservoirs and airflow control concepts.
  3. The modern breakthrough (2003–2004) — The device widely acknowledged as the progenitor of today’s market was developed and patented in China in the early 2000s. That design combined an atomizer, battery and liquid nicotine delivery system in a compact, consumer-friendly form and was quickly commercialized. This milestone is the clearest answer to the query when was e cigarette invented in terms of market impact and modern usability.
  4. Global commercialization and iteration (2006–2015) — Following commercialization, companies around the world refined form factors, battery systems, coil technologies and e-liquid chemistry. Marketing, product diversification and user innovation turned a single invention into a broad industry with specialized products known today as e-zigaretten, vapes, pod-systems and mods.
  5. Regulation and public health focus (2014–present) — As use increased, governments and public health bodies began to regulate ingredients, flavors, marketing and sales. Scientific studies on harm reduction and youth uptake influenced policy and the pace of innovation.

Technical anatomy: what the original design introduced that still matters

The early successful design introduced several technical elements that persist across contemporary e-zigaretten: a rechargeable battery, a heating element (atomizer), a liquid reservoir or cartridge, a mouthpiece and an airflow mechanism that triggers vapor generation. Innovations since then focus on coil materials, wicking methods, battery safety, temperature control, nicotine salt formulations and compact pod systems. Understanding the original functional blocks helps explain why the invention’s date remains relevant: the fundamental architecture has been stable even as components have improved.

Product evolution: from first commercial models to today’s diversified market

First-generation devices were relatively simple: a larger battery and a refillable tank or replaceable cartridge. Over time, manufacturers experimented with form factors and materials, producing:

  • closed pod systems designed for ease of use;
  • refillable tanks favored by hobbyists;
  • high-powered box mods that allow temperature control and variable wattage;
  • nicotine salt formulations optimized for throat hit and rapid nicotine absorption;
  • disposable vapes targeting convenience markets.
